HypersomniacLive: Oh, I'm not complaining, just wanted to make sure I actually understand how the algorithm works.
And it's quite understandable that checking all user pages manually isn't any fun. ;-)
Oh. You aren't complaining at all. You're helping me improve MaGog.
Through your reporting of this I was able to identify 5 users whose wishlists my algorithm had missed. Thank you.
For 4 of those I was able to slightly modify the algorithm to identify their wishlists as well. Already done.
For 1 of those I just couldn't find a suitable simple modification of the algorithm. Guess who?
The issue with your page (and I believe you are unique in this) is that what precedes the wishlist is neither the title ("My Wishlist") nor the subtitle "oo many and still adding to it! ;-P". It's the green User Information box.
I could find some ugly workaround (e.g. if ($user eq "HypersomniacLive"), the first list on the page is the wishlist), but I'd rather not go there because it'll surely break some day when you edit your page and, say, add an owned list.
Your page's metadata looks like this:
== * My Wishlist * ==
'''''I know, I know - too many and still adding to it! ;-P'''''
{{Userinfo
|name = HypersomniacLive
|gog.com = yes
|avatar = yes
|caption2 = Disguised Insomniac
|gogname = HypersomniacLive
|joined = yes
|days = yes
}}
<gog-wishlist user="HypersomniacLive" />
== * My Game Shelf * ==
'''''Slowly but steadily working on it! ;-)''''' What I suggest is that you move the subtitle so that it comes between the User Information box and the wishlist and add 'wish' or 'want' or 'desire' to it somewhere (e.g. '''''I know, I know - too many wants and still adding to it! ;-P''''').
Then drop me a note and I will check that the algorithm handles it correctly.
P.S. Having 40+ games on your wishlist is not that much. There are people with more than 400.